  • Publication number: 20060168839
    Abstract: A layer on a semiconductor substrate is scanned with a stream of heated gas to bake the layer. A baking apparatus includes a stage that supports the semiconductor substrate and a gas injector that expels the stream of the heated gas. The stage and the gas injector are moved relative to one another to scan the substrate with the stream of heated gas and thus, bake the layer that is disposed thereon. Fumes emanating from the layer are removed while the layer is scanned. To this end, the apparatus also includes a vacuum head that is fixed in position relative to the gas injector.

  • Patent number: 7018814
    Abstract: Provided is a method of purifying a vancomycin from a fermentation broth of a microorganism containing vancomycin, including passing the fermentation broth of a microorganism containing vancomycin through a strong acid cation exchange resin, a weak base anion exchange resin, alumina and a hydrophobic absorbent resin sequentially.
